River Plate began to make moves in the market with an unusual clarity: Marcelo Gallardo wants a revolution in the midfield and has already conveyed his priorities to the board.
The coach, back and determined to rebuild his structure, requested two specific names to form a competitive double pivot for 2026: Santiago Ascacíbar and Fausto Vera, as reported by TNT Sports.
River Plate and Gallardo's plan for a new midfield
River Plate understands that the departure of Enzo Pérez left a tactical and emotional void that has not yet been filled. Gallardo, aware of that open wound, is pushing to add quality in an area he considers crucial. To achieve this, he sees Fausto Vera as an ideal piece for his intensity and ability to maintain the rhythm in highly demanding matches.
The former Argentinos Juniors player, sidelined at Atlético Mineiro, is considering a return to the country if negotiations progress. River Plate has already initiated formal contacts and is awaiting a response from the Brazilian club in the coming days. The operation won't be easy, but there is optimism at the Monumental due to the player's desire to become a protagonist again.

Marcelo Gallardo insists on Ascacíbar and boosts the project
Marcelo Gallardo also put forward the name of Santiago Ascacíbar, an option gaining strength within the club due to his contractual situation at Estudiantes. The midfielder is entering the last year of his contract, facilitating negotiations that seemed impossible months ago.
Ascacíbar has not hidden his interest in competing for titles again and, reportedly, has already listened to the coaching staff’s proposal for a complementary partnership with Fausto Vera. Club officials confirmed that the initial talks were positive, sparking optimism internally. River Plate sees Ascacíbar as an ideal player to strengthen the defensive phase and give the team a competitive profile that characterized Gallardo's best cycles.
The coach aims for a modern double pivot: aggressive, dynamic, and with quick reading abilities. He believes Ascacíbar can provide defensive pressure and Vera can bring balance in build-up play, a combination that, in his view, could restore the identity lost in recent tournaments. The board agrees with this assessment, understanding the need for high-profile reinforcements to support Gallardo's vision in a year filled with competitions.
River Plate evaluates alternatives and accelerates decisions
River Plate also considered the possibility of bringing back Aníbal Moreno, currently at Palmeiras, but his economic and contractual situation distances him from their radar. The Brazilian club demands high figures, and the player is not pushing for a transfer, so Gallardo urged to proceed directly with Santiago Ascacíbar and Fausto Vera. Within the club, there is a belief that securing both signings before the start of the preseason would assert dominance in the Argentine market. Initial negotiations are already setting a clear path. Both Ascacíbar and Vera are open to wearing the red and white jersey and competing for a spot in the starting eleven. Their profiles align with the reconstruction led by the coach, aimed at restoring intensity, organization, and character to the team.
The River Plate squad is moving swiftly, with a clear plan and the full support of Marcelo Gallardo in each decision. The arrival of Santiago Ascacíbar and Fausto Vera could completely transform the core of the team and rebuild a key area for collective performance. The club knows that its next competitive jump depends on reinforcing this sector, hence the rapid and resolute progress in negotiations.
